May I suggest you expand your range of fabric to include an interlock knit in cotton/lycra, rayon/lycra or bamboo/lycra? It will give you more options to work with. The Doc's top appears to be made with an interlock or jersey knit which you can find in various fiber combinations. I found a bunch of striped fabric at The Fabric Fairy. I'm sure one of these will work for what you're looking for.The Doc's top also has ribbing at the neckline which is available at Fabric.com.
